Voyager Fleet Card programs from trusted partners

U.S. Bank Voyager partners with oil, leasing and other industry companies to offer the Voyager Fleet Card. Each partner offers solutions that can help you manage fleet expenses from anywhere across the United States. Your drivers get an easy-to-use payment solution, while you get the control and oversight you need.
